求10个任意数的最大小值
[b]/* Note:Your choice is C IDE */#include "stdio.h"
void main()
{
int i,input[10],smax,smin,sum=0;
for (i=0;i<10;i++)
{
scanf("%d",&input[i]);
if (i==0)
smax=smin=input[i];
else
{
if (input[i]>smax)
smax=input[i];
if (input[i]<smin)
smin=input[i];
}
}
for (i=0;i<10;i++)
printf("%d ",input[i]);
printf("max=%d,min=%d\n",smax,smin);
}
有哪位高人能替我分析一下其中的原理吗???